11/27/2023 0 Comments Windows xp sounds driver![]() Installing Sound Drivers in Windows 9x and Windows NT Guest Operating Systems Windows 2000, Windows XP and most recent Linux distributions automatically detect the sound device and install appropriate drivers for it. MIDI input is not supported, and no MIDI support is available for Linux guests. MIDI output from Windows guests is supported through the Windows software synthesizer. wav files, MP3 audio and Real Media audio. Sound support includes PCM (pulse code modulation) output and input. The VMware Workstation sound device is enabled by default. VMware Workstation provides a sound device compatible with the Sound Blaster Ensoniq AudioPCI and supports sound in Windows 95, Windows 98, Windows Me, Windows NT, Windows 2000, Windows XP, Windows Server 2003 and Linux guest operating systems.
